Charles Crutchfield awards 1968-1982.

The collection consists of a small assortment of papers (certificates of appreciation, awards, etc.), and photographs concerning the career of Charles Crutchfield, from 1968 to 1982. The collection also contains three 3-dimensional objects.

12 linear inches

Crutchfield, Charles Harvey, 1912-1998

http://n2t.net/ark:/99166/w6qv3jwc (person)

Charles Harvey Crutchfield was born in Hope, Ark., on 27 July 1912, grew up in Spartanburg, S.C., and matriculated at Wofford College for one year, 1929-1930. He began his career in broadcasting in 1929 as a radio announcer and worked at a number of radio stations before joining the staff of WBT in Charlotte, N.C., in 1933.
